Measuring Renters in Credit Data: Evidence from Linked Survey and Administrative Data
Abstract: Historic swings in rents during the pandemic have driven increased interest in research on the financial impacts of rising rents on households. However, compared to homeowners with a mortgage, data on renters are scarce, limiting researchers' ability to analyze the 28 percent of adults who rent their home.
